Output 324cb5e2797cb4fae18abe81eda65722a8f7c597b56a5c834fe69bd8abb0d6b6:17

value
1389940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2353b6842d757c3262889a91b294e489765b93aa OP_EQUAL
address
34uorjdgM7DJ3vVjmCA7zMHWHd4rKyfmT3
transaction
324cb5e2797cb4fae18abe81eda65722a8f7c597b56a5c834fe69bd8abb0d6b6
spent
true